Background & Fellowship Description

The Women in Agriculture Leadership Program Fellowship is a two-year, non-residential initiative led by African Women in Agricultural Research and Development (AWARD) under the Africa-Australia Partnership for Climate-Responsive Agriculture.

The programme is designed to strengthen the capability, confidence and influence of African women agricultural scientists so they can contribute to and lead climate-responsive agricultural research and agrifood systems.

The current call is for the second cohort, with applications closing on November 6, 2026.

What the Fellowship Offers

Selected Fellows participate in professional development activities including:

  • Leadership and negotiation training
  • Mentoring and peer-learning opportunities
  • Gender integration in climate adaptation
  • Science communication
  • Research proposal writing
  • Technical capacity development
  • Professional networking
  • Opportunities to strengthen leadership in agricultural research and agrifood systems

The fellowship is non-residential, allowing participants to continue their professional work while undertaking the programme.

Qualifications and Eligibility

The fellowship targets mid-career African women agricultural scientists working in national agricultural research institutions, government ministries, universities and international research organisations.

Applicants must generally:

  • Be nationals of Egypt, Morocco, Ghana, Nigeria, Sierra Leone or Senegal.
  • Hold at least a Master’s degree in a relevant discipline.
  • Have a minimum of seven years of professional experience in agriculture and agrifood systems, including relevant gender or climate-related work.
  • Be actively engaged in research, policy, or practice relevant to climate-responsive agriculture.
  • Reside in Africa throughout the fellowship.
  • Have proficiency in English or French.

How to Apply

Applications must be submitted online through the official AWARD application portal. English- and French-speaking candidates have separate application routes.

Applicants should review the official fellowship information and eligibility requirements carefully before submitting their applications.
